Nice is a wonderful city on the sea. The plane has to do a big U turn to come is as the runway is on the beach and you think you are landing in the sea.

20220401_134314.jpg
When you land , the city is around 10 minutes by tram to the city centre which is great. The city is on the sea so a walk down the promenade was done to start off the visit but it was fairly windy I tell you. I would say it is unreal in summer. The city like many other French cities has an old town with narrow higgeldy piggeldy streets and nice little food and chocolate shops along the way. We are staying in a lovely little hotel called the Grimalde just off the main restaurant street. The restaurants are lovely here so we are eating well. We decided not to include breakfast in the hotel as going to the little French cafes in the morning is part of the experience. If you ask for a coffee in Nice you get an espresso so I am getting used to them at this stage. Many people complain about French food but I have always find it very tasty. The service is always a bit slow in France but that is there way. They don't rush anything and I quite like the long sit down over a number of courses.
